How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Candler Park?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Candler Park Studio Apartments | $1,941 | $1,050 | $9,929 |
Candler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,192 | $995 | $6,859 |
Candler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,012 | $1,250 | $10,000+ |
Candler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,194 | $1,675 | $10,000+ |
Candler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$6,934 | $2,015 | $10,000+ |

Getting Around the Candler Park Neighborhood in Atlanta, GA
Walk Score®
77 / 100
Very Walkable
Most err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
70 / 100
Very Bikeable
Biking is convenient for most trips
Transit Score®
54 / 100
Good Transit
Many nearby public transportation options
